This section will present job market trends, salary ranges, and skill demand for the following roles in the UK: 1. **Risk Analyst**: These professionals assess potential risks in farming operations and develop strategies to mitigate their impact on the business. With a growing emphasis on data-driven farm management, the demand for risk analysts is on the rise. 2. **Farm Manager**: Farm managers oversee daily operations, ensuring efficient use of resources and maximizing crop yields. As technology transforms agriculture, farm managers with skills in automation and data analysis are increasingly sought after. 3. **Agricultural Engineer**: Agricultural engineers design and develop innovative technologies to improve farming efficiency, sustainability, and safety. With growing pressure to produce more food for a growing population, the demand for agricultural engineers is expected to increase. 4. **Supply Chain Manager**: Supply chain managers coordinate the movement of agricultural products from farms to consumers. With the need to balance efficiency and resilience in the face of disruptions, professionals with expertise in supply chain management are in high demand. 5. **Commodity Trader**: Commodity traders buy and sell agricultural products in the global market, aiming to maximize profits for their organizations. With fluctuating market conditions and geopolitical uncertainties, commodity traders need to stay up-to-date with the latest trends and developments in the industry.
